Asda have been forced to close their Hereford store this lunchtime, following technical difficulties.

Customers reported issues with the checkouts, with one customer saying that the store had experienced a power cut and that customers were unable to pay for their shopping.

The store has since been closed, with reports that a technician is on the way from Cheltenham to fix the issue. The store was full of shoppers purchasing food and drink ahead of what is set to be a scorcher of a weekend, with temperatures expected to hit 30c in Herefordshire.
